How you'll contribute
A Certified Nurse Aide CNA who excels in this role:
Perform basic patient care tasks including bathing, grooming, and mobility assistance.
Provide general nursing support such as positioning, lifting, turning, and using special equipment.
Assist with toileting needs using bedpans, urinals, commodes, or ambulation to the bathroom.
Take and record temperature, pulse, respiration, weight, height, blood pressure, and intake/output measurements accurately and document in a timely manner.
Prepare patient rooms for admission and transfer, ensuring cleanliness and equipment readiness.
Maintain a clean, comfortable, and safe environment with attention to ventilation and lighting.
Support patient admission, transfer, and discharge procedures, including handling of patient belongings.
Answer patient call lights, phones, and pages, responding promptly and appropriately.
Perform other related duties as assigned.
What we're looking for
Requires critical thinking skills, decisive judgment and the ability to work with minimal supervision.
Must be able to work in a stressful environment and take appropriate action.
PCA experience preferred.
Education : Required: High school diploma or equivalent and completion of a nursing assistant training course
Experience:
Minimum six months of experience in an acute care or long-term care setting preferred
Licenses : Current state certification as a Nursing Assistant
Certifications : CPR/BCLS certification required.

More about Longview Rehabilitation Hospital
Longview Rehabilitation Hospital is a state-of-the-art, 36-bed inpatient acute rehabilitation hospital in Gregg County dedicated to helping individuals regain their independence and return to the lives they love following an injury or illness. Longview Rehabilitation Hospital is CARF-accredited for our Comprehensive Integrated Inpatient Rehabilitation and Stroke Therapy Program.
